    This video saved me a ton of money. Thank you. But my trunk problem was a little different. It opened about 2 times out of 10 tries with the key fob. I was getting constant TRUNK AJAR alerts every time I put the transmission in drive/reverse or stepped on the brakes. My auto door locks were also activating constantly.....about 3-4 times a second. I had to pull over on a long drive home and open/close the trunk to get the short circuit to stop. I was also seeing the dome light in the trunk dim and brighten when the trunk lid moved up and down. I heard a slight buzzing from the trunk latch whenever I opened it while the ignition was on. I unwound the trunk wire harness and saw the broken black and white wire. The wrap was keeping it together enough to cause a short circuit and not a complete trunk failure. I used a butt splice connector after stripping the wiring insulation and it solved all of the issues 100%. Two other wires had some stripped insulation so I put electrical tape over them. The stripping seems to have occurred due to the too-tight zip tie from the Ford factory. I installed a new tie with a bigger loop to take tension off of the wiring harness. If a wire short circuit or wire break happens to anyone on a long drive and the auto door locks keeping firing over and over again, there are online procedures and TH-cam videos that show how you can turn the feature off until you can repair the wire.

    Thanks guy - My 2012 Focus has that problem. there are 4 wires to the connector on the trunk release. I pulled the plug and have voltage on 3 out of 4. One pulses with the key control. Looks like the 4th is the ground or return. It ohms 18 Meg ohm to ground (open). Looks like bad wire and now thanks to you I know better where to look. I wish I could find a decent wiring diagram of this thing. The Focus car sites say to buy an entire harness rather than just fix the wires like you did. (You are smarter.) That trunk alarm drives me crazy.
